ABOUT US

PHINIA: Advancing sustainability today, powering a cleaner tomorrow.  

 

PHINIA is an independent, market-leading, premium solutions and components provider with over 100 years of manufacturing expertise and industry relationships, with a strong brand portfolio that includes DELPHI®, DELCO REMY® and HARTRIDGE™. With over 12,500 employees across 43 locations in 20 countries, PHINIA is headquartered in Auburn Hills, Michigan, USA.

JOB PURPOSE

The Finance Manager provides financial leadership, governance, and commercial insight across manufacturing operations, inter site transactions, budgeting and forecasting, investment decisions, and revenue growth initiatives.
The role acts as a financial authority and decision enabler, balancing strong financial discipline with operational and commercial pragmatism. It owns complex financial evaluations end to end and partners closely with Operations, Supply Chain, and Commercial teams to support both business continuity and growth.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

Budget, Business Plan & Forecast Ownership

  • Owns the annual Budget and Business Plan working cross functionally in line with plant strategic objectives.
  • Leads and oversees the monthly forecast process, ensuring timely, accurate, and aligned financial outlooks.
  • Coordinates inputs across operational and commercial stakeholders, challenging assumptions and ensuring consistency.
  • Provides clear visibility of risks, opportunities, and variances to plan, supporting proactive decision‑making.

Operational & Inter‑site Financial Governance

  • Financial owner for inter‑site and intercompany transactions, including pricing logic, approvals, and accounting treatment.
  • Ensures robust cost control, inventory valuation, and financial compliance while enabling operational execution.
  • Resolves ambiguity in pricing, sourcing, and ownership through clear financial direction.

Business Case Ownership & Investment Evaluation

  • Owns the full business case lifecycle from initial concept through to final financial recommendation.
  • Leads data collection, assumption validation, and financial modelling to produce accurate, decision‑ready financial expectations.
  • Provides clear visibility of commitments, investment requirements, returns, risks, and sensitivities.
  • Acts as the financial owner of assumptions and recommendations presented to leadership.

Revenue Expansion & Commercial Partnership

  • Actively participates in revenue growth and expansion initiatives.
  • Evaluates the financial attractiveness of growth opportunities, including margin, investment, and risk.
  • Challenges commercial and operational assumptions to ensure growth is profitable, sustainable, and value‑accretive.
  • Supports prioritization of opportunities based on return, risk, and strategic alignment.

Team Management

  • Lead and develop finance team ensuring succession and progression in place
